The next instalment of The Grappling Dummy!
In this episode, I talk to Nic Gregoriades, a black belt under Roger Gracie.
Nic was kind enough to come down to our gym and give a BJJ workshop, and give his time to make this video.
We talk about what it’s like to train with Roger Gracie, and about the Jiu Jitsu Brotherhood (an online BJJ community).
We also have a little roll while Nic shares his philosophies on jiu jitsu.
After that, Nic does something a little different and offers a “shadow grappling” routine. Something simple that you can practice when you don’t have a partner, that allows you to continue to work on your body skills.
